aboutsummaryrefslogtreecommitdiffstats
path: root/config
diff options
context:
space:
mode:
authorGuillaume2017-11-03 16:20:06 +0100
committerGuillaume2017-11-03 16:20:06 +0100
commita9216c0457f81c9c27f6ec5d3100941b68ddf9e4 (patch)
treeae73f172e54b1dd4501f9749484d1496182974cd /config
parentf201d7cdd68ca554e7a99eb791baf48a540b8978 (diff)
parent75988d4b5d821266131aec86e33c67eda0c38dcb (diff)
downloadchouette-core-a9216c0457f81c9c27f6ec5d3100941b68ddf9e4.tar.bz2
Merge branch 'master' into 4755-page_for_validate_referential
Diffstat (limited to 'config')
-rw-r--r--config/environments/test.rb3
-rw-r--r--config/locales/compliance_controls.en.yml13
-rw-r--r--config/locales/compliance_controls.fr.yml17
-rw-r--r--config/locales/import_messages.en.yml4
-rw-r--r--config/locales/import_messages.fr.yml4
-rw-r--r--config/locales/imports.en.yml6
-rw-r--r--config/locales/imports.fr.yml6
-rw-r--r--config/routes.rb1
8 files changed, 42 insertions, 12 deletions
diff --git a/config/environments/test.rb b/config/environments/test.rb
index b3312be4a..8bf94f5da 100644
--- a/config/environments/test.rb
+++ b/config/environments/test.rb
@@ -62,6 +62,9 @@ Rails.application.configure do
# Reflex api url
config.reflex_api_url = "https://195.46.215.128/ws/reflex/V1/service=getData"
+ # IEV url
+ config.iev_url = ENV.fetch('IEV_URL', 'http://localhost:8080')
+
config.rails_host = "http://www.example.com"
# file to data for demo
config.demo_data = "tmp/demo.zip"
diff --git a/config/locales/compliance_controls.en.yml b/config/locales/compliance_controls.en.yml
index 887bc2009..41971d9e9 100644
--- a/config/locales/compliance_controls.en.yml
+++ b/config/locales/compliance_controls.en.yml
@@ -2,6 +2,17 @@ en:
compliance_controls:
clone:
prefix: 'Copy of'
+ filters:
+ criticity: Severity
+ name: "Search by a control's name or code"
+ subclass: Object
+ subclasses:
+ generic: 'Generic'
+ journey_pattern: 'JourneyPattern'
+ line: 'Line'
+ route: 'Route'
+ routing_constraint_zone: 'RoutingConstraint'
+ vehicle_journey: 'VehicleJourney'
min_max_values: "the minimum (%{min}) is not supposed to be greater than the maximum (%{max})"
errors:
incoherent_control_sets: "Impossible to assign a control to a set (id: %{direct_set_name}) differing from the one of its group (id: %{indirect_set_name})"
@@ -179,4 +190,4 @@ en:
compliance_control_block: "Control Block"
minimum: "Minimum"
maximum: "Maximum"
- target: "Target" \ No newline at end of file
+ target: "Target"
diff --git a/config/locales/compliance_controls.fr.yml b/config/locales/compliance_controls.fr.yml
index 2feb201bf..3fa83a147 100644
--- a/config/locales/compliance_controls.fr.yml
+++ b/config/locales/compliance_controls.fr.yml
@@ -2,6 +2,17 @@ fr:
compliance_controls:
clone:
prefix: 'Copie de'
+ filters:
+ criticity: Criticité
+ name: "Chercher le nom ou code d'un contrôl"
+ subclass: Objet
+ subclasses:
+ generic: 'Généric'
+ journey_pattern: 'JourneyPattern'
+ line: 'Ligne'
+ route: 'Itinéraire'
+ routing_constraint_zone: 'ITL'
+ vehicle_journey: 'Course'
min_max_values: "la valeur de minimum (%{min}) ne doit pas être superieur à la valuer du maximum (%{max})"
errors:
incoherent_control_sets: "Le contrôle ne peut pas être associé à un jeu de contrôle (id: %{direct_set_name}) différent de celui de son groupe (id: %{indirect_set_name})"
@@ -119,7 +130,7 @@ fr:
activerecord:
models:
compliance_control:
- one: "controle"
+ one: "contrôle"
other: "contrôles"
route_control/zdl_stop_area:
one: "Deux arrêts d’une même ZDL ne peuvent pas se succéder dans un itinéraire"
@@ -130,7 +141,7 @@ fr:
route_control/duplicates:
one: "Détection de double définition d'itinéraire"
route_control/opposite_route_terminus:
- one: "Vérification des terminus de l'itinéraire inverse"
+ one: "Vérification des terminus de l'itinéraire inverse"
route_control/minimum_length:
one: "Un itinéraire doit contenir au moins 2 arrêts"
route_control/omnibus_journey_pattern:
@@ -179,4 +190,4 @@ fr:
compliance_control_block: "Groupe de contrôle"
minimum: "Minimum"
maximum: "Maximum"
- target: "Cible" \ No newline at end of file
+ target: "Cible"
diff --git a/config/locales/import_messages.en.yml b/config/locales/import_messages.en.yml
index 2048b9794..bf6b45020 100644
--- a/config/locales/import_messages.en.yml
+++ b/config/locales/import_messages.en.yml
@@ -1,8 +1,8 @@
en:
import_messages:
compliance_check_messages:
- corrupt_zip_file: "The zip file of WorkbenchImport %{import_name} is corrupted and cannot be read"
- inconsistent_zip_file: "The zip file of WorkbenchImport %{import_name} contains the following spurious directories %{spurious_dirs}, which are ignored"
+ corrupt_zip_file: "The zip file %{source_filename} is corrupted and cannot be read"
+ inconsistent_zip_file: "The zip file %{source_filename} contains unexpected directories: %{spurious_dirs}, which are ignored"
referential_creation: "Le référentiel n'a pas pu être créé car un référentiel existe déjà sur les même périodes et lignes"
1_netexstif_2: "Le fichier %{source_filename} ne respecte pas la syntaxe XML ou la XSD NeTEx : erreur '%{error_value}' rencontré"
1_netexstif_5: "%{source_filename}-Ligne %{source_line_number}-Colonne %{source_column_number} : l'objet %{source_label} d'identifiant %{source_objectid} a une date de mise à jour dans le futur"
diff --git a/config/locales/import_messages.fr.yml b/config/locales/import_messages.fr.yml
index 9f0af1faa..7d3bbf23b 100644
--- a/config/locales/import_messages.fr.yml
+++ b/config/locales/import_messages.fr.yml
@@ -1,8 +1,8 @@
fr:
import_messages:
compliance_check_messages:
- corrupt_zip_file: "Le fichier zip du WorkbenchImport %{import_name} est corrompu, et ne peut être lu"
- inconsistent_zip_file: "Le fichier zip du WorkbenchImport %{import_name} contient les repertoirs illegeaux %{spurious_dirs} qui seront ignorés"
+ corrupt_zip_file: "Le fichier zip %{source_filename} est corrompu, et ne peut être lu"
+ inconsistent_zip_file: "Le fichier zip %{source_filename} contient des repertoires non prévus : %{spurious_dirs} qui seront ignorés"
referential_creation: "Le référentiel n'a pas pu être créé car un référentiel existe déjà sur les même périodes et lignes"
1_netexstif_2: "Le fichier %{source_filename} ne respecte pas la syntaxe XML ou la XSD NeTEx : erreur '%{error_value}' rencontré"
1_netexstif_5: "%{source_filename}-Ligne %{source_line_number}-Colonne %{source_column_number} : l'objet %{source_label} d'identifiant %{source_objectid} a une date de mise à jour dans le futur"
diff --git a/config/locales/imports.en.yml b/config/locales/imports.en.yml
index f3bcad9e9..10434dd19 100644
--- a/config/locales/imports.en.yml
+++ b/config/locales/imports.en.yml
@@ -55,8 +55,10 @@ en:
other: "imports"
errors:
models:
- imports:
- wrong_file_extension: "The imported file must be a zip file"
+ import:
+ attributes:
+ file:
+ wrong_file_extension: "The imported file must be a zip file"
attributes:
import:
resources: "File to import"
diff --git a/config/locales/imports.fr.yml b/config/locales/imports.fr.yml
index 6e74fa33c..099488a6b 100644
--- a/config/locales/imports.fr.yml
+++ b/config/locales/imports.fr.yml
@@ -55,8 +55,10 @@ fr:
other: "imports"
errors:
models:
- imports:
- wrong_file_extension: "Le fichier importé doit être au format zip"
+ import:
+ attributes:
+ file:
+ wrong_file_extension: "Le fichier importé doit être au format zip"
attributes:
import:
resources: "Fichier à importer"
diff --git a/config/routes.rb b/config/routes.rb
index 214b12584..30ba51358 100644
--- a/config/routes.rb
+++ b/config/routes.rb
@@ -74,6 +74,7 @@ ChouetteIhm::Application.routes.draw do
resources :api_keys, :only => [:edit, :update, :new, :create, :destroy]
resources :compliance_control_sets do
+ get :simple, on: :member
get :clone, on: :member
get :select_compliance_control_set
resources :compliance_controls, except: :index do